How to Extend the Lifespan of Your Power Bank: An Overview

  • Written by Modern Australian

Power banks are vital for ensuring your devices are powered while on the go, especially when on the move, outdoors, or during emergencies. They provide a portable and practical solution for charging tablets, smartphones, and other USB-powered devices when the power outlet isn't available.

In addition, extending the longevity of your power bank doesn't require significant adjustments in how you utilize it; however, it will require you to be aware of the things you do that could affect its longevity and performance. In this article, we'll explore the many aspects that affect power bank longevity and what you can do to make your power banks function at their best and last longer.

Factors Affecting Power Bank Lifespan

Several factors impact lifespan and can affect the life of your bank, such as the frequency of use, storage conditions, charging habits, and more.

Regarding storage, frigid weather can enormously impact your energy bank, dramatically reducing its power storage capacity and, in some cases, making it unusable and stop functioning.

In addition, charging habits can impact how the powerbank functions and the length of time it lasts, as the number of instances and the amount you're charging can impact the bank's lifespan.

How to extend the battery life of your power bank and increase its capacity

Never Overcharge It

Portable chargers called power banks can keep your devices fully charged whenever needed. However, misuse of power banks could cause battery degradation and capacity loss. One of the most common mistakes users make is charging too much for their energy bank.

When charging your power bank, keep it at no more than 80%. Charging an energy bank at 100% can reduce its life span and decrease capacity.

Avoid Fully Depleting the Power Bank Battery

One of the best guidelines for prolonging the lifespan of your Power Bank Battery is not to let it discharge completely. Batteries, particularly those made of lithium-polymer and lithium-ion, which are commonly used in power banks, are more degraded when drained to the point of 0%. You should recharge your power bank whenever the battery's level is around 20% to 30%. This practice helps to keep the battery in good condition and prolong the battery's longevity.

Store Your Power Bank Correctly

When you store your power bank, it is recommended to store it in a dry and cool location free of heating sources, dust, or moisture.

Traveling using your power bank is normal because that's what they're for! However, during a hot summer day, you should be aware of putting the power bank in direct sunlight or excessively hot areas, such as inside your vehicle.

A power bank has several delicate components, and extreme temperatures (both cold and hot) can damage them, resulting in a loss of functionality.

Use the Right Charging Cable

A poor-quality or incompatible charging cable could damage the Power Bank Battery over time. Low-end wires are often not equipped with proper insulation and could cause voltage fluctuations that harm the power bank's battery cells. Always choose high-end cables, particularly ones that are included with your power bank or suggested by the manufacturer.

Avoid Using the Power Bank While Charging

Utilizing this energy bank to charge your devices when connected and charging them simultaneously could add extra strain. This process creates temperatures and can cause the battery to go between charging and discharging simultaneously, decreasing its lifespan. Don't use the battery until it is fully charged and unplugged from the power source to extend its lifespan.

Use the Power Bank Regularly

Regular usage is indeed suitable for your Power Bank Battery. Like any other rechargeable battery, leaving it in a non-use state for long periods could result in deterioration. It is recommended to use your energy bank regularly, at least once per month, and completely recharge it (charge it to a maximum of 100% and then let it go down to 20-30 percent) to ensure it stays in good condition.

Monitor The Temperature While Charging

When you charge your power bank, the temperature is crucial. Avoid extreme temperatures, such as cold or hot, as this could damage the battery and shorten its lifespan. Instead, try for an average temperature of 5 to 40 ° Celsius.

Invest in a High-Quality Power Bank

There are many different models of power banks, and not all are created equal. Some less expensive models might have inferior components that degrade faster. Investing in an excellent power bank will ensure your battery lasts longer and performs better. You should look for reliable brands and models with good reviews to ensure you get a durable and long-lasting power bank.

Conclusion

Maximizing the longevity of the Power Bank Battery is all about following good charging practices and keeping your device clean and properly stored. Following the suggestions discussed above, you can ensure that your power bank remains in top condition for the longest time possible. If you take care of it, your power bank will keep your devices fully charged and ready to go whenever you require them.
